Artist:                   LEGEND
Title:                      Playing with Fire (Live 1992)
Cat No:                 NF CD 2
Label:                    NoFish Productions
Released:            31st May 2010
 
Nearly 18 years in the making...
In October 1992 at the request of their Japanese label Legend performed a special concert in their home town of Runcorn which was filmed for a broadcast concert video. The resultant video was called ‘Playing with Fire’ and saw limited release on VHS format. At the time Legend wanted to release it as a live CD, but finances didn’t allow. Approximately 2 years ago Steve Paine stumbled on the analogue video masters and the idea of releasing ‘Playing with Fire’ as a CD was re-born.
Playing with Fire captures the bands first live performance with the line up that was to complete Second Sight album and the live premieres of 4 of the songs from Second Sight alongside six of the tracks from their debut CD. It is rough and ready and resurrected from the original analogue source tapes, but it is nonetheless a real snapshot of the band at a crucial stage in their development.
